• How do you preserve ‘old Florida' with a growing population? Cedar Key residents may have the answer (wuft.org) — Cedar Key residents are working hard to protect their small-island, “old Florida” character even as population growth, hurricanes, and development pressures reshape much of the state. Locals, artists, and city leaders describe how community ties, historic buildings, and even the town’s imperfect, marshy coastline help preserve a slower, more authentic way of life. Their efforts are drawing academic attention as a model for keeping Florida’s heritage alive.
   

• Florida's mangroves add a layer of hurricane protection that humans can't (wcjb.com) — Mangrove forests around Cedar Key are doing quiet but vital work, helping knock down storm surge, waves, and wind before hurricanes reach shore. Experts explain how these trees, along with salt marshes and oyster reefs north of Cedar Key, offer natural protection that concrete can’t match and are now safeguarded by state law against overdevelopment. Understanding these habitats can help residents better appreciate their first line of defense.
   

• After devastating fire, USF marine scientists race to keep ocean monitoring on track (usf.edu) — USF marine scientists are working urgently to keep Gulf monitoring buoys running, which help forecast storm surge levels like those Cedar Key saw during Hurricane Idalia. After a major fire damaged their main lab, the team quickly regrouped, salvaged key equipment, and returned to sea so their models can better protect coastal communities this hurricane season.
